From 02b808b08acc73b9b3d31832a7f137a9aae4bdd9 Mon Sep 17 00:00:00 2001 From: Francisco Jerez Date: Sun, 7 Apr 2013 18:31:06 +0200 Subject: [PATCH] clover: Fix usage of incorrect object as destination in clEnqueueCopyBufferToImage. Signed-off-by: Francisco Jerez --- src/gallium/state_trackers/clover/api/transfer.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/gallium/state_trackers/clover/api/transfer.cpp b/src/gallium/state_trackers/clover/api/transfer.cpp index 295d6c7b29e..7e6b26f9603 100644 --- a/src/gallium/state_trackers/clover/api/transfer.cpp +++ b/src/gallium/state_trackers/clover/api/transfer.cpp @@ -414,7 +414,7 @@ clEnqueueCopyBufferToImage(cl_command_queue q, cl_mem src_obj, cl_mem dst_obj, const size_t *dst_origin, const size_t *region, cl_uint num_deps, const cl_event *deps, cl_event *ev) try { - image *dst_img = dynamic_cast(src_obj); + image *dst_img = dynamic_cast(dst_obj); validate_base(q, num_deps, deps); validate_obj(q, src_obj); -- 2.30.2